> I have map a different war deployment at the root of several different
> name-based virtual hosts.  In other words, http://a.foo.com and
> http://b.foo.com should map directly to separate .war files.
> 
> Right now, I have two separate war deployments, each with a jboss-web.xml.
> They look like:
> 
> <jboss-web>
>       <context-root>/</context-root>
>       <virtual-host>a.digidemic.com</virtual-host>
> </jboss-web>
>  
> and
> 
> <jboss-web>
>       <context-root>/</context-root>
>       <virtual-host>b.digidemic.com</virtual-host>
> </jboss-web>
> 
> but I am getting an error:
> 
> 10:52:19,448 ERROR [URLDeploymentScanner] MBeanException: Exception in MBean
> operation 'checkIncompleteDeployments()'
> Cause: Incomplete Deployment listing:
> Packages waiting for a deployer:
>   <none>
> Incompletely deployed packages:
> [org.jboss.deployment.DeploymentInfo@716004b8 {
> url=file:/C:/dev/jboss-3.0.1_tomcat-4.0.4/server/default/deploy/b.war/ }
>   deployer: org.jboss.web.catalina.EmbeddedCatalinaServiceSX@ff2e265c
>   status: Deployment FAILED reason: Error during deploy; - nested throwable:
> (java.lang.IllegalArgumentException: addChild:  Child name '' is not unique)
>   state: FAILED
>   watch:
> file:/C:/dev/jboss-3.0.1_tomcat-4.0.4/server/default/deploy/b.war/WEB-INF/web
> .xml
>   lastDeployed: 1032360729806
>   lastModified: 1032360644054
>   mbeans:
> ]MBeans waiting for classes:
>   <none>
> MBeans waiting for other MBeans:
>   <none>
> 
> It makes sense what is going on, both are trying to use the same root
> mapping.  
> 
> Is there a way around this?
